[OpenBIOS] [PATCH 1/2] iso9660: Fix Forth return value for iso9660_files_open()

Andreas Färber andreas.faerber at web.de
Sun Sep 26 23:01:05 CEST 2010


There's a mixup of 0 and -1. Don't return failure if iso9660_open() succeeded. Don't return success in case
iso9660_open() or iso9660_mount() failed.

This resolves both a hang when trying to boot cd:,\\:tbxi and failure to boot either cd:,\ppc\bootinfo.txt
or cd:,\ppc\chrp\bootfile.exe despite present on the AIX 6.1 disk.
